In a landmark move under the Renewed Hope Initiative, the Federal Government of Nigeria has announced the complete elimination of tuition and other school fees across all 33 Federal Science and Technical Colleges (FSTCs) for the 2025–2026 academic session.

Starting August 2025, enrollees in these institutions will enjoy an unprecedented package of benefits: free tuition, free meals, free accommodation, monthly stipends, and a guaranteed pathway to employment or entrepreneurship after graduation. This initiative aims to revolutionize Technical and Vocational Education and Training (TVET) nationwide.

A New Era for Technical Education
The TVET program is designed to equip students with practical, industry-relevant skills in high-demand sectors such as construction, engineering, hospitality, and healthcare. Graduates will receive dual certification: the National Technical Certificate and the National Skills Qualification Certification (NSQ) — both recognized internationally.

Key Benefits for Enrolled Students:

Free tuition for the entire 3-year program

Free meals and accommodation throughout the training period

Monthly stipends for student upkeep

Access to federal grants or loans to start a business after graduation

National and international certification for employment or self-employment opportunities

Registration Details:
Interested candidates can register at any of the 33 FSTCs nationwide.

Registration fee: ₦4,200 only

Deadline for registration: Thursday, 12th June 2025

Entrance examination date: Saturday, 14th June 2025, at 9:00 AM at selected FSTCs

Note: No late registration will be accepted

This initiative reflects the federal government’s commitment to expanding access to quality technical education, reducing youth unemployment, and fostering a generation of job-ready, self-reliant graduates.
